no human involved

Meaning · English

Describing crimes committed against people deemed undesirable or subhuman, e.g., those with criminal records, sex workers, drug addicts, transients, or people of color.

⚠ Register: derogatory, slang

Where it’s used: Used American English

Examples

He was not working with what the police facetiously call a no-humans-involved case, where everyone involved whether as witness or suspect already has a substantial criminal record.
